Roche seeks a Senior Scientific Software Engineer in Basel to build full-stack analytical tools that transform complex data into insights for drug discovery.
This position belongs to the Analytics and Workflows group within Roche’s Computational Sciences Center of Excellence. The team focuses on converting intricate data into actionable insights for drug discovery, operating at the intersection of data science, medicinal chemistry, and engineering to create robust analytical platforms.
Responsibilities
- Collaborate with medicinal chemists, cheminformaticians, and AI scientists to comprehend molecular design and analysis workflows.
- Develop end-to-end platforms that include front-end interfaces, backend services, and data integrations.
- Lead the creation of intuitive and extensible user experiences for complex scientific workflows, emphasizing interactive visualization.
- Architect and implement APIs, data models, and services for scalable, data-intensive applications.
- Evaluate and apply emerging technologies, including AI-assisted development tools, to accelerate iteration.
- Work with distributed scientific, engineering, and design teams to move ideas from exploration to production.
Requirements
- A Ph.D. in engineering, physical, or quantitative discipline with 2+ years of experience, or BS/MS with 5+ years of relevant industry experience.
- Proven track record of designing and building modern web applications across the full stack.
- Expertise in creating interactive, data-rich visualizations using web-based libraries.
- Experience designing and implementing APIs, data services, and application architectures for scientific workflows.
- Proficiency in leveraging modern AI-assisted and agentic coding practices.
- Ability to work effectively with complex datasets in scientific contexts using Python- or R-based tools.
- Fluency working with data pipelines, cloud infrastructure, and distributed systems.
Nice to have
- Comfortable reasoning about chemical structures and molecular design workflows, including core chemoinformatics concepts.
